A heavy, slanted sans with rounded, swollen counters and broad, compact letterforms. Strokes are uniformly thick with minimal modulation, and curves dominate the construction, giving bowls and apertures a soft, inflated feel. Terminals tend to be blunt and slightly angled, and the overall rhythm is lively with a forward-leaning stance and tight internal spaces that emphasize mass. Figures share the same chunky, rounded geometry, keeping the set visually consistent in display sizes.

Best suited to headlines, posters, and bold brand moments where a friendly, high-energy voice is needed. It can work well for sports and entertainment branding, packaging callouts, and logo wordmarks that benefit from a compact, punchy silhouette. For longer copy, it’s most effective in short bursts—taglines, pull quotes, or emphasis—where its dense weight and slant remain easy to parse.

The overall tone is energetic and approachable, with a bold, sporty attitude that reads as upbeat rather than severe. Its rounded shapes and pronounced slant give it a dynamic, poster-like presence with a hint of retro signage and casual branding.

The design appears intended to deliver maximum impact with a forward-driving, rounded sans structure, balancing assertiveness with approachability. Its geometry prioritizes strong silhouettes and smooth curves to create a distinctive, lively display texture.

The slant and weight create strong texture in lines of text, producing a dense, high-impact word shape. The round forms stay prominent even in tight apertures, which reinforces the font’s “bubble” character and makes it feel designed for attention-grabbing settings rather than delicate typographic nuance.
